	* cancel.c: Rearranged some code and introduced checks
	to disable cancelation at the start of a thread's cancelation
	run to prevent double cancelation. The main problem
	arises if a thread is canceling and then receives a subsequent
	async cancel request.
	* private.c: Likewise.
	* condvar.c: Place pragmas around cleanup_push/pop to turn
	off inline optimisation (/Obn where n>0 - MSVC only). Various
	optimisation switches in MSVC turn this on, which interferes with
	the way that cleanup handlers are run in C++ EH and SEH
	code. Application code compiled with inline optimisation must
	also wrap cleanup_push/pop blocks with the pragmas, e.g.
	  #pragma inline_depth(0)
	  pthread_cleanup_push(...)
	    ...
	  pthread_cleanup_pop(...)
	  #pragma inline_depth(8)
	* rwlock.c: Likewise.
	* mutex.c: Remove attempts to inline some functions.
	* signal.c: Modify misleading comment.
